Original Description
Boulevard Des Italiens by Anatole Eugène Hillairet transports viewers to the vibrant heart of 19th-century Parisian life with its bustling energy and luminous atmosphere. Painted during Haussmann’s transformation of Paris, the work captures the iconic boulevard’s lively cafés, elegant pedestrians, and grand architecture under soft daylight—a hallmark of Hillairet's keen observation and realist approach. As a lesser-known yet gifted student of the Barbizon School, Hillairer blended academic precision with subtle Impressionistic touches, creating dynamic urban scenes that rival his contemporaries like Caillebotte or Pissarro. While not as widely celebrated as Monet’s boulevards, this piece remains significant for its documentary charm and transitional style, bridging Romanticism’s detail and Impressionism’s fleeting light—a hidden gem of Belle Époque artistry.
